The term "Biological Yield" was given by Nichiporovich.
Biological yield refers to the total dry matter produced by a crop (including both economic and non-economic parts).
It is related to economic yield through the harvest index.
West, Briggs and Kid (A): Developed growth analysis equations.
Watson (B): Contributed to growth analysis.
Blackman VS (C): Contributed to growth analysis.
Thus, Nichiporovich gave the term Biological Yield.
